Norway's aquaculture industry generates significant volumes of high-organic-load waste—from uneaten feed to fish faecal matter—most of which ends up as unmanaged emissions or is lost to marine ecosystems.
An industrial-scale circular bioeconomy facility that captures this underutilised marine waste stream and transforms it into biogas, clean electricity, and regenerative compost through anaerobic digestion and composting.
Converts aquafeed residue and fish faecal matter into energy and soil inputs
Reduces nutrient discharge to fjords and marine dead zones
Avoids >1,700 tons of COâ‚‚e emissions annually
Supports climate-aligned aquaculture and blue economy innovation
Aligns with Norway's Bioeconomy Strategy and EU Clean Industrial Law targets
